This Double Bubble Map visually contrasts the experiences of white individuals to black individuals during the Jim Crow era. On the white side, there are images of better amenities such as a water fountain, cafeteria, and classroom. These images suggest that white individuals had access to superior facilities and resources in public spaces.
On the black side, there are images of worse amenities such as a water fountain, cafeteria, and classroom. These images depict the discriminatory practices that African Americans faced during this time, where they were provided with lower-quality facilities compared to their white counterparts.
Overall, this map highlights the stark disparities in treatment and opportunities based on race during the Jim Crow era.
